Hi Guys,

So today, after some months I decided to check my storage via, About This Mac > Storage

I was surprised to see that both my drives were only displaying 'Other', please see attached screen print, when in actual fact, I know my set up is as follows:

Main drive (OWC SSD) 240gb > Applications only
Secondary HHD (Original HHD shipped with MBP) - Photos, Videos, Documents etc

So I was expecting the displays to show the above information correctly.

Unfortunately, I have no idea what may have caused this and having searched the World Wide Web, I am unable to find the solution, to my issue(s).

I would be eternally grateful if someone can point me into the right direction to how I can resolve my issue(s).

Any help will be more than appreciated. I own an early 2011 MBP.

Looks like the volumes are excluded in Spotlight preferences, which means it can't index and so just calls everything "Other".

Go to System Preferences -> Spotlight -> Privacy-tab. Remove the volumes there.
